The Cloth Diaper is Less Expensive

The cloth diaper is reusable. This means that you can buy just about six diapers and you’re all set. The expenses you incur for these diapers are one-time, and will not be recurring. In these financially trying times, one needs to look after his expenses too. Cloth diapers offer a way for parents to save up on their expenses for diapers, savings that they can allocate to another one of baby’s needs.

The disposable diaper is the exact opposite of that. After one is used, you throw it away and replace it with another. If your supply runs out, you go out and buy fresh ones. At the rate that it goes, a parent will spend quite a lot on disposable diapers because babies urinate and defecate a lot of times. This high price you spend is what you get in exchange for the convenience you enjoy from disposable diapers.
